What’s your best kept secret? We have one – and it’s kind of a big deal. For WinField® United Canada, it’s the not-so-hidden gem Answer Plot® field scale trial site. Located East of Saskatoon, Answer Plot is a research site dedicated to agronomic learning and evaluation. Since 2018, WinField United has been using Answer Plot to showcase the latest and greatest innovations, along with agronomy training demos. Trial Data Capture
No product ever comes to market with a line of “try this, it doesn’t work”. Every registered product works somewhere, under a specific set of conditions. Answer Plot aims to find answers to what those conditions are, so you can have confidence selling your growers solutions. Answer Plot is an opportunity to consistently capture local, relevant data on how a product or seed hybrid performs. This is a story about far more than just yield, with in-season trial measurements and data capture throughout the growing season to help explain why, or why not, a yield difference occurred. Trials are taken to harvest and weighed for differences between treatments. Knowing this full scope of information allows WinField United and their independent ag retail partners (and growers) to have an extra degree of confidence in the results that are garnered. This information is then disseminated to retails over the fall and winter months, starting with the Agronomy Academy coming up December 2 and 3 in Saskatoon.   

What does Answer Plot 2026 have in store?
Trials this year feature a plethora of different product types. Let’s dig in further:
 
  1. Deposition Demos - Some say you can’t adequately show how droplets land on a crop canopy...we say, where there’s a will, there’s a way. With the unique blackout tent creation, participants will get the opportunity to see the LockTech® difference firsthand.
  2. Mode of Action Demos - Corteva Agriscience™, Gowan®, Nufarm, ADAMA®, and UPL will showcase their innovations with these demos explaining how different herbicides and fungicides work, and application tips for that can take it from great to exceptional.
  3. Canola Hybrid Trials - CROPLAN® hybrids in LibertyLink®, TruFlex®, and the new Optimum® GLY hybrid will be compared to industry standards to see how they stack up against other brands in the industry. With the CROPLAN lineup expanding to include three trusted Corteva Agriscience canola hybrids for 2027, its future is bright.
  4. Canola Seed Treatment Trials - Flea beetles, cutworms, and blackleg are problems no one needs. Answer Plot is comparing the newest seed treatment option to existing offerings, to determine which has the best power against early season pests.
  5. Fertilizer Availability Impact on Plant Vigour -  KOCH™ Agronomic Services will showcase their brand-new phosphorous availability enhancing product, demonstrating side-by-side comparisons so attendees can see the changes in plant growth and vigour themselves.
  6. Spraying Tips and Tricks – WinField United Canada’s Market Development team has been hard at work spraying trials to specifically address the most common concerns brought forward by retailers each spray season. From how to improve lamb’s quarter’s control in LibertyLink canola to water quality impacts on glyphosate performance, there are six different stations you’re not going to want to miss.
